11b40326fc60982d8fd78f40ad411dda8b9824c79f882a7fadfe0ec143ac59ea

2046649 (379 blocks ago)

432254857

⏴ Block 2046648 (1675163b...cf2) | Block 2046650 ⏵ | Latest block ⏭

Metadata

15/2/26, 5:40 am UTC (12:38:24 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 32.2289 SENT

Transactions (0)

Show raw details